大家好,今天小编关注到一个比较有意思的话题,就是关于java语言寿命的问题,于是小编就整理了4个相关介绍Java语言寿命的解答,让我们一起看看吧。
- 如何延长Java程序员的职业寿命?
- C++程序员的职业寿命大概能比Java程序员长多少?C++能否缓解Java的中年危机?
- 为什么编程语言中c++的价值比java的价值大?
- 手机用时间长了内存不足,可以通过恢复出厂设置,以达到清空储存延长手机寿命的目的吗?
如何延长J***a程序员的职业寿命?
职业生命周期程序员都会遇到 要么提前转行 要么就让自己一直沉淀下去 延长职业寿命 首先呢自身的知识结构 和技术要一直不断学习 不断成长 不断扩展自身岗位边界 然后呢不断积累行业经验 互联网本身更新淘汰也快 只有让自己不断学习 不断深入才能走得更远 时时提升自己的核心竞争力 往更高级的程序员发展
持续性的学习。
开始时我们努力学会独立,快速,高质量完成任务,慢慢需要追求团队式的作战,协同开发,积累经验,总结规律,进而努力尝试站到更高纬度去参与到技术设计中,成为团队的大脑。
c++程序员的职业寿命大概能比J***a程序员长多少?C++能否缓解J***a的中年危机?
纯软件开发并没有多少区别,cpp比j***a好在它面向的业务复杂。
cpp主要对设备编程,每个行业都有相应专业的设备需要开发,比如电子行业,你不光要编程,还有懂电子电路,光电子电路就是一个专业体系,编程好做,电子难学。这是cpp不容易被替代的原因,不是编程本身有什么难,实在是它面向的业务难。
j***a从二十岁到三十岁都在增删改查,你写得熟练点也没什么优势,哪怕你用cpp增删改查一样没优势。
现在的互联网开发走入了一个误区,一直撸框架底层,什么这个功能咋实现,那个功能什么原理,这没什么卵用,你会也仅仅是卷赢一份工作,互联网业务本身是没有门槛的
作为一个在编程行业里“耕深多年”的老程序员,并且近五六年作为面试官负责招聘程序员是我工作内容之一。我对市场行情及各个编程语言的发展情况是非常了解的。下面结合实际情况,我来说明一下这两个问题。
第一个问题:这几年经常招聘各种IT岗位(c++市场需求远少于J***a),以及行业从事c++朋友的现状不太乐观(换工作选择空间很小)。所以综合来看,“c++从职业寿命来看比J***a会短”。主要两个原因:1.定位不同,c++应用偏底层,应用范围小,如操作系统、嵌入式开发等。而J***a的应用范围较广,web应用、ai、大数据、安卓等。2.语言生态,多年发展下来,J***a因为入门简单(对比c++)、开源、功能强大,已经形成了强大的生态体系,各种领域的开源框架、组件应有尽有。
第二个问题:答案是“不能”,因为它们两之间在市场行情上没有太多必然的联系。
简单总结一下,编程语言之间的比较,是这个行业常态化的事情。在另一个角度看,有时候也是程序员们互相调侃的一种方式。编程语言在市场的发展肯定会有受众大小的区别,建议大部分程序员还是需要选择主流编程语言,更有助于自己的职业发展。当然如果你特别喜欢底层编程语言或小众编程语言,那你就得加倍努力,做到这项编程语言的技术专家,那你的发展肯定也是极好的!
为什么编程语言中c++的价值比j***a的价值大?
两个都是渣渣,J***a优点是runtime版本对应的话,基本不用担心兼容性问题。但是现在新一点推出的语言基本都可以实现。语言层面j***a的优势基本是在于生态,一套东西改改接口就能用。但是对于小企业,更应该考虑go这种语言,开发web后台服务的速度不相上下,而且可以直接编译成armV7目标代码,跑在linux。根本不用担心什么并发,生命周期。小企业那几年寿命和几十的日活,跟着阿里去琢磨J***a,在想什么呢。c++更离谱,要么写屎,要么投入昂贵的人力花大力气去去实现[_a***_]或者go轻松实现的设计模式。别说硬件调用其他厂商的方面了,用rust加个自动接口的工具,比c++的开发效率高多了。唯一阻碍小企业用更好的语言的原因,是他们招不到人。
手机用时间长了内存不足,可以通过恢复出厂设置,以达到清空储存延长手机寿命的目的吗?
手机分RAM和ROM内存,比如魅族16S就分6+128GB的,6GB就是RAM,128GB是ROM。
RAM是手机运行速度除了CPU之外的一个很重要的元件,这个元件就相当于电脑的C盘一般,RAM越大可以将的软件就越多运行速度就越快。
而ROM就是平时我们的存储空间,ROM越大,你可以放的文件 照片 音乐 电影就越大,对于手机运行速度影响较小。
而我们手机特别是安卓手机使用时间长了之后,RAM就会留有大量的缓存和垃圾,会严重的影响手机运行速度,我一般的做法是:及时关闭一些不使用的软件(手动)、二删除一些长时间不应用的软件、三及时通过一些管理软件清理缓存和清理使用软件留下的垃圾,然后就会发现手机运行速度变快了。
ROM的清理也可以通过软件来管理,清除微信(这个是一占内存的大户)、相同的照片、内存里的大型文件等,把一些垃圾清除了。
但您说的是应用都安装不下了,我觉的您使用了三年了,可以恢复下出厂设置并且格式化下内存了,但是在之前,先把一些重要的数据先保存了(联系人 重要的照片等)。
处于数码时代之中,各式各样的电子产品更新换代速度飞快,隔三差五的数月里便又有新一代的产品诞生,取而代之的是便又是一个新阶段。就这样,那些用着同一台手机好几年的朋友们,手机纷纷出现卡顿、内存不足等问题,但手机还没坏暂时不想换呀,这是就出现了一些疑问,通过恢复出厂设置会对这类型问题有帮助吗?
首先,我们需要知道的是手机的使用寿命其实是很矛盾的,要看看从哪个角度分析,从我们普通用户的使用来说当然是越长越好,反之对商家而言使用寿命越长就代表着商机越少。所以在大众市场上的手机使用寿命一般只有三年左右,原因不仅是配置问题还可能需要对市场进行控制。
而手机在使用三年过后,逐渐会出现了内存不足或是卡顿现象,这时候有的人就会觉得把手机恢复出厂设置就可以清空手机释放内存啦。对于这种说法,我个人觉得不完全错误,因为从表面来看通过恢复出厂设置,清理手机的缓存,确实可以缓解内存不足的情况,但这并不能解决根本问题。手机在长期使用后,随着各种手机软件的升级,内存也会相应增加,每升级一次内存需求就大一次,久而久之手机很自然会出现内存不足的情况,说明手机性能已经无法满足你目前运行需求了,造成了打游戏会卡、经常性提醒内存不足等情况。
手机恢复出厂设置其实只是缓兵之计,毕竟造成手机使用寿命缩短的原因不单是软件,硬件也会老化,导致很多手机使用久了电量也会用得快,这时就需要更换电池了。所以说,造成手机内存不足的原因很多样,若选择恢复出厂设置的话,也应先对手机的资料进行备份以免丢失。像我一般会使用天翼云盘帮手机备份,当手机处于WiFi的环境且电量不低于20%时,手机的照片视频都可以自动备份到云盘里,一来不怕手机数据丢失,二是定期备份可以减轻手机内存压力。所以应该养成定期备份的习惯,不然等手机断断续续出现问题,使数据丢失就为时已晚了。希望我的见解对你有帮助啦!